The Infrastructure Investments Group ("IIG" or the "Group") is a dedicated team and business unit within JPMAM Global Alternatives focused on advising a perpetual-life strategy that offers investors a moderate-risk, long-term approach to private infrastructure equity investing that is diversified both in terms of geography and subsector.

The strategy advised by IIG is one of the largest of its kind with over US$30 billion in committed capital under management, representing approximately 10 times growth in assets under management over the past 10 years.

The current portfolio includes 20 companies that in turn own c.800 underlying assets globally.


The strategy focuses on active management through control positions (majority equity ownership) in private companies as the long-term owner of companies that provide essential services (water, heat and electricity), such as renewable energy; water, natural gas and electric utilities; and trains and airports, which are all vital to the economic health and productivity of the communities in which they operate.

Geographically the strategy is focused primarily in the U.S., Canada, Western Europe, Australia, and secondarily in other OECD countries.


Facilitated by the perpetual structure, the strategy in particular targets sustained growth through both new investments and capital deployment via bolt-on acquisitions to existing platform companies.

Control positions permit significant influence on investments and IIG strives to add value via the formulation and implementation of business process improvements, active asset management and board of director participation.


Providing local essential services - with employees, customers and communities that often overlap - requires the investments IIG advises to be well-governed, have a strong culture and be stewards of the environment in order to fulfill the terms of their social license to operate (safe, reliable, affordable, sustainable).
